What is a Veranda Configurator?

A veranda configurator is an online or software-based tool that allows users to create custom designs for verandas. It typically features a user-friendly interface where customers can select dimensions, styles, and materials, and see their choices in real time. By generating 3D visualizations, the configurator helps clients better understand how their choices will look in reality.

How to Use a Veranda Configurator Effectively

Understanding how to manipulate a veranda configurator can significantly impact the quality of your design and the overall experience. Here’s how to navigate this powerful tool for the best results.

Step-by-Step Guide to Designing Your Veranda

  1. Start with Your Space: Measure the area where you plan to install the veranda. Input these dimensions into the configurator as your starting point.
  2. Choose Your Style: Select a style that complements your home’s architecture. Options may include contemporary, classic, or rustic designs.
  3. Select Materials: Choose from various materials, such as wood, aluminum, or glass. Consider durability and maintenance requirements.
  4. Customize Features: Add elements like lighting, railings, and furniture to see how various configurations change the aesthetic.
  5. Review and Adjust: Use the 3D model to scrutinize your design from different angles, making modifications as necessary.
  6. Save and Share: Once satisfied, save your design and share it with family or professionals for feedback.

Common User Challenges and How to Overcome Them

While using a configurator can be exciting, users may face challenges such as:

  • Overwhelm with Choices: Start with a clear vision of what you want to achieve to narrow down options efficiently.
  • Understanding Technical Terms: Familiarize yourself with basic terminology to navigate the configurator effectively.
  • Visualization Discrepancies: If the 3D representation doesn’t match expectations, adjust materials or colors to find a better fit.
  • Technical Issues: Ensure you have a stable internet connection and a compatible device to avoid disruptions.

FAQs About Veranda Configurators

How does a veranda configurator save time and money?

By enabling quick design adjustments and allowing visualizations before building, a veranda configurator reduces costly mistakes and saves time during the decision-making process.

Can I customize more than just size with a configurator?

Absolutely! Most configurators allow various customizations, including style, materials, and additional features like lighting and furnishings.

What materials can I visualize using a veranda configurator?

Common materials include wood, aluminum, glass, and various composites. The configurator will typically provide samples for users to visualize.

Are veranda configurators suitable for both B2B and B2C?

Yes, configurators can be tailored for both business-to-consumer and business-to-business applications, serving a wide range of clients from homeowners to commercial developers.

How do I share my designs with others?

Most configurators provide options to export designs as images or links. This feature enables users to easily share their creations via email or social media.
